Common furnace symptoms Rockford homeowners call about

If your furnace shows any of the following signs, it needs professional attention. Early diagnostics prevent small issues from becoming major repairs.

  • Furnace won’t start or cycles on and off frequently
  • Weak or no heat coming from vents
  • Unusual noises: banging, rattling, screeching, or humming
  • Persistent pilot light or ignition failures
  • Thermostat not responding or inconsistent temperatures
  • Blower runs but no heat is produced
  • Higher than normal utility bills after heating season starts
  • Odors of burning or gas smell (this requires immediate action)
  • Visible soot, rust, or corrosion around the furnace

Simple homeowner troubleshooting steps before the technician arrives

These basic checks can help identify obvious problems or make the repair process faster, but they are not a substitute for professional diagnostics.

  • Confirm thermostat settings: Ensure the thermostat is set to heat and the setpoint is at least a few degrees above room temperature.
  • Check power and switches: Verify the furnace switch and breaker are on. Many furnaces have a power switch near the unit that resembles a light switch.
  • Inspect air filter: A dirty filter restricts airflow and can cause the system to overheat or short-cycle. Replace if visibly clogged.
  • Look for error codes: Newer furnaces display error codes on a control board or LED. Note the code for the technician.
  • Check pilot or ignition indicator: For older units with standing pilots, ensure the pilot light is lit. For electronic ignition systems, note if the furnace attempts to ignite.

If you smell gas, leave the house immediately, avoid creating sparks, and follow your gas provider safety steps. Contact a professional immediately. Everest Air Heating and Cooling is experienced with these safety scenarios and the steps needed to secure your home.

Most common furnace repair issues in Rockford, TN

Below are the frequent root causes our technicians diagnose and repair on Rockford homes. Each issue includes a straightforward explanation and common solutions.

  • Ignition and pilot problems
    • Cause: Worn igniter elements, faulty flame sensors, clogged pilot orifice, or gas valve issues.
    • Effect: Furnace fails to light or cycles through ignition attempts and then locks out.
    • Typical repair: Replace igniter or flame sensor, clean pilot assembly, or replace gas valve. Test ignition cycle after repair.
  • Blower motor and fan failures
    • Cause: Worn bearings, failed capacitors, debris in blower wheel, or electrical faults.
    • Effect: Reduced airflow, buzzing or screeching sounds, or blower not running.
    • Typical repair: Clean blower assembly, replace motor or capacitor, balance or replace fan wheel.
  • Thermostat faults and control issues
    • Cause: Calibration drift, wiring faults, dead batteries (in programmable thermostats), or failed control boards.
    • Effect: Inaccurate temperature control, short cycling, or no call for heat.
    • Typical repair: Recalibrate or replace thermostat, tighten or replace wiring, or service the control board.
  • Limit switch and safety control trips
    • Cause: Restricted airflow, dirty coils, or malfunctioning switches.
    • Effect: Furnace shuts down to prevent overheating.
    • Typical repair: Clear airflow restrictions, replace failed limit switch, and test safety circuits.
  • Gas pressure and valve problems
    • Cause: Maladjusted regulators, failing gas valve, or supply interruptions.
    • Effect: Weak or no flame, sputtering, or odor of unburned gas.
    • Typical repair: Adjust gas pressure within code limits, replace defective valves, and verify safe operation.
  • Heat exchanger cracks and corrosion
    • Cause: Age, metal fatigue, or poor maintenance.
    • Effect: Potential carbon monoxide risk and inefficient operation.
    • Typical repair: Replacement of the heat exchanger or recommendation for system replacement if the unit is past economical repair. All work includes safety testing.
  • Ductwork and airflow restrictions
    • Cause: Collapsed ducts, closed dampers, or leaks.
    • Effect: Cold spots, uneven heating, and increased runtime.
    • Typical repair: Seal and insulate ducts, repair leaks, and rebalance airflow.

Diagnostic procedure: how we find the real problem

Rapid symptom checks are useful, but accurate repair depends on a systematic diagnostic approach. Everest Air Heating and Cooling follows a documented troubleshooting workflow for furnace repair in Rockford, TN.

  1. Visual and safety inspection
    • Inspect the furnace area for debris, corrosion, soot, and signs of water leaks.
    • Confirm combustion venting and clearances are correct.
    • Check for gas odor and perform a leak check if indicated.
  2. Confirm controls and power
    • Verify thermostat call for heat, power to the furnace, fuse and breaker status, and control board indicators.
    • Record any error codes displayed.
  3. Sequence-of-operation test
    • Run the furnace through a startup cycle while monitoring each stage: thermostat call, inducer motor startup, ignition attempt, fuel flow, flame establishment, and blower engagement.
    • Note where the sequence deviates from expected behavior.
  4. Component testing
    • Test ignition components, flame sensor, pressure switches, limit switches, blower motor amperage and capacitor integrity, gas valve operation, and transformer voltages.
    • Use combustion analyzer for gas furnaces if flame quality is a concern.
  5. Airflow and distribution check
    • Inspect filters, return and supply vents, and ductwork to ensure adequate airflow and identify restrictions that can cause repeated faults.
  6. Safety testing
    • For suspected heat exchanger issues or incomplete combustion, perform a carbon monoxide check and inspect the heat exchanger visually where possible.
    • Confirm proper venting and flue draft.
  7. Diagnosis and clear recommendation
    • Present a clear diagnostic summary that explains root cause, recommended repair options, parts involved, and an estimate for labor and parts.

This layered approach ensures repairs address the underlying cause, not just the symptom, extending the life of your furnace and increasing reliability in Rockford weather.

Safety checks and follow-up testing after repair

Every furnace repair we complete in Rockford, TN includes post-repair testing to verify performance and safety.

  • Complete startup and run cycle to confirm reliable ignition and operation
  • Combustion and draft testing on gas furnaces when relevant
  • Carbon monoxide checks in the equipment area and commonly occupied spaces
  • Temperature rise measurement across the heat exchanger to verify correct operation
  • Blower speed and airflow checks to confirm balanced heating distribution
  • Thermostat calibration and sequence testing for proper control

After work completes, technicians document what was done and the test results so homeowners understand the condition of their system and the expected performance.

When repair is not the best option

Furnace repairs extend equipment life, but there are times when replacement is the most practical, economical, and safe choice. Common indicators that replacement should be considered include:

  • Repeated costly repairs within a short timeframe
  • Unit age beyond its expected service life (typically 15 to 20 years for conventional furnaces)
  • Signs of heat exchanger failure or severe corrosion
  • Significant efficiency losses resulting in unacceptably high gas usage during Rockford winters
  • Difficulty finding parts for obsolete equipment

When replacement is recommended, we provide objective information about system sizing for your home, efficiency options that match local climate needs, and expected long-term savings from newer equipment.

Preventive maintenance to avoid emergency repairs

Regular maintenance is the most effective way to reduce unexpected furnace failures and keep systems operating efficiently in Rockford’s variable climate. Key preventive measures include:

  • Biannual inspections: Fall heating check ensures safe operation before heavy use; spring inspection prepares your system for occasional cool nights and reduces offseason issues.
  • Filter replacement: Check or replace filters monthly during heavy use months. A clean filter protects components and maintains airflow.
  • Combustion and venting inspection: Ensure flues, chimneys, and vent connectors are clear and drafting properly.
  • Blower and motor service: Lubrication (where applicable), cleaning, and capacitor checks extend motor life.
  • Thermostat calibration: Ensure consistent indoor comfort and efficient run time.
  • Duct inspection and sealing: Leaky ducts reduce efficiency and cause uneven heating.

Q: Can a dirty filter cause my furnace to shut down?
A: Yes. A clogged filter restricts airflow, raises internal temperatures, and can trigger safety limit switches that shut the furnace down to prevent overheating.

Q: What are common noise causes in furnaces?
A: Rattling or banging can be caused by loose panels or ductwork, screeching often indicates motor bearings or belt issues, and a loud boom at startup can signal delayed ignition or dirty burners. Each symptom has a specific diagnostic path.

Q: Will a thermostat upgrade improve reliability?
A: Upgrading to a modern programmable or smart thermostat can improve comfort control and reduce wear by preventing short cycling. However, it will not fix mechanical faults in the furnace itself.
